    The Beantown Interiors Optimization patch v3.2.1 (03/19/18 )

    There are now three versions of the optimization patch all have been cleaned with the xEdit Pre-Combined Cleaning Script. 
     
    The Beantown Interiors Optimization patch v3.2 (Season Pass) 
     
    This version requires, 
    • Automatron
    • Far Harbor 
    • Vault-Tec Workshop
    • Nuka World
    • The Beantown Interiors Project v9.3.2
    The reason for this is that one of the CC updates updated some of the Pre-Combined meshes in Arutomatron and my original patch had conflicts with it. 
     
    The Beantown Interiors Optimization patch 3.2.1 (Vault-Tec)
     
    This version requires, 
    • Far Harbor,
    • Vault-Tec Workshop,
    • Nuka world, 
    • The Beantown Interiors Project v9.3.2
    I had already finished this version before I noticed the Automatron culling issues and figured it was done so I would release for the people who may not have Automatron. 
     
    The Beantown Interiors Optimization patch v3.2.1 (No New Requirements)
     
    This version requires,
    • Far Harbor,
    • Nuka World,
    • The Beantown Interiors Project v9.3.2
    This version is for people who don't have all the DLC.

      Have you tried  Beantown Interiors Project True Interior Patch?  It moves all the Beantown Interiors Project content that is in the exterior cells into separate interior cells, boards up the windows and walls up any open spaces, and puts a door on each building to enter.  So all that content in open buildings like in downtown Boston are no longer in the exterior cells, and you should get same performance as vanilla. 

      There's some other useful features, e.g. you can also hide the BTIP buildings altogether with the BTIP holotape, as this patch adds a True Interior Patch section that allows you to hide nearest BTI building.  I really only find this useful in Jamaica Plain in conjunction with Rebuild JP.
